How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Coastal Brevard?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Coastal Brevard Studio Apartments | $1,326 | $895 | $2,986 |
| Coastal Brevard 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,634 | $1,000 | $5,221 |
| Coastal Brevard 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,979 | $1,246 | $7,766 |
| Coastal Brevard 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,999 | $1,453 | $10,000+ |
| Coastal Brevard 4 Bedroom Apartments | $9,166 | $1,995 | $10,000+ |
| Coastal Brevard 5 Bedroom Apartments | $10,406 | $5,950 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Coastal Brevard
How much are Studio apartments in Coastal Brevard?
There are currently 183 Studio Apartments in Coastal Brevard with rent ranges from $895 to $2,986 with an average price of $1,326.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Coastal Brevard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Coastal Brevard ranges from $1,000 to $5,221 with an average monthly rent of $1,634.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Coastal Brevard c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Coastal Brevard range from $1,246 to $7,766.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,979.
How expensive are Coastal Brevard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 143 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Coastal Brevard on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,453 to $15,473 - averaging $2,999 for the location.
